Tuna are animals that players can kill for meat.

Behaviour[edit | edit source]
Typically, Tuna will swim in the water.
Hunting[edit | edit source]
Tuna can be Fished using a Fishing Pole or caught in a Fish Trap.
Strategy[edit | edit source]
- Fish Traps are the most common way to capture fish in Eco as it idly catches them compared to a Fishing Pole.
